Techniques for designing dashboards that surface data lineage and transformation logic for audit and debugging.
This evergreen guide presents practical, step-by-step methods for crafting dashboards that reveal data lineage and transformation logic, enabling reliable audits, faster debugging, and stronger governance across complex analytics pipelines.
July 15, 2025
Facebook X Reddit
Designing dashboards that reveal where data originates and how it evolves is essential for trustworthy analytics. A robust approach starts with establishing a clear map of data sources, each with associated metadata about capture times, formats, and owners. Next, integrate lineage traces that show every transformation, aggregation, and join applied along the journey. The goal is to provide a transparent, navigable view that stakeholders can explore without needing deep technical prowess. A well-constructed dashboard also communicates trust by highlighting data quality signals, such as schema changes, missing values, and anomaly indicators, all linked to the transformation steps responsible. With this foundation, audits become more straightforward and debugging more efficient.
To build an audit-ready dashboard, begin by cataloging every ingestion path and transformation rule in a centralized catalog. This catalog should feed a lineage surface that is interactive, allowing users to trace a data point from its original source through each intermediate state. When users click on a metric, they should see the exact filter conditions, join keys, and aggregation logic that produced it. Embedding time-context—when a rule was active and who modified it—further strengthens accountability. The dashboard should also show dependency graphs that illustrate how downstream analyses rely on upstream datasets, enabling impact analysis whenever changes occur in the pipeline.
Build actionable lineage views with interactive validation and alerts
Transparency in data pipelines is achieved by exposing both lineage and the underlying transformation logic in a digestible form. A practical design places a dedicated lineage module front and center, with an expandable tree that reveals each data source, intermediate state, and final asset. Accompanying this visualization, provide concise explanations of each transformation rule, including business intent and constraints. Users should be able to compare two versions of a transformation to understand what changed and why. Such clarity makes it easier to explain results to stakeholders and to reproduce analyses in controlled environments, strengthening confidence across data teams and executives.
ADVERTISEMENT
ADVERTISEMENT
Beyond static diagrams, interactivity fuels deeper understanding. Implement filters that let viewers focus on specific datasets, time ranges, or business domains. Hover tooltips can reveal metadata like lineage depth, data steward, last updated timestamp, and quality indicators. A side panel should list validation results for each step, showing pass/fail statuses and remediation notes. When failures occur, the dashboard can trigger alerts that point directly to the responsible transformation block, its configuration, and the source data signals that indicated the issue. This responsive design accelerates root-cause analysis and minimizes downtime.
Provide clear, versioned history of rules and data contracts
A practical dashboard design emphasizes actionable signals rather than passive visuals. Start with a top-level health score derived from data quality signals, then offer drill-down paths into lineage for items that require attention. Each data asset should have a concise data contract, describing acceptable ranges, expected null handling, and performance goals. The contract links to the precise rule in effect, so auditors can see whether the current state conforms to agreed standards. Alerts should be contextual, referencing the lineage path and showing expected vs. observed values, making it easier to pinpoint deviations and initiate corrective actions quickly.
ADVERTISEMENT
ADVERTISEMENT
Version control is a cornerstone of auditable dashboards. Track changes to ingestion scripts, transformation rules, and visualization configurations so users can compare snapshots over time. The interface should support viewing diffs that highlight parameter updates, new joins, or dropped fields, with explanations authored by data engineers. By tying each change to a ticket or approval record, teams create an audit trail suitable for compliance reviews. When combined with lineage diagrams, versioned artifacts enable precise historical reconstruction of any dataset, helping teams validate decisions and defend analytics outcomes.
Integrate governance links and contextual explanations for every node
Effective dashboards balance depth with clarity. A hierarchical layout guides users from a high-level overview into increasingly detailed layers of lineage and transformation logic. Start with a global map of pipelines and domains, then allow exploration into specific datasets. Each dataset card should summarize origin, destination, latency, and current quality metrics. Clicking the card reveals the full transformation chain, including function names, parameter values, and any conditional logic. By maintaining consistent naming conventions and descriptive labels, the interface becomes intuitive even for non-technical stakeholders who still require solid audit trails.
Documentation and storytelling are powerful companions to technical visuals. Include short narrative blocks that describe the business purpose of each transformation and the rationale behind critical design choices. The dashboard should support comparisons between historical and present-day states, so auditors can assess whether changes align with approved governance policies. When possible, link lineage views to external documentation such as data dictionaries, policy documents, and regulatory guidelines. This integrated approach makes audits smoother and helps teams demonstrate responsible data stewardship.
ADVERTISEMENT
ADVERTISEMENT
Proactive debugging and traceability enable reliable analytics
A mature dashboard blends governance controls with real-time visibility. Each node in the lineage graph should display who owns the data, permissible operations, and applicable data protection requirements. Contextual notes can explain why a transformation was implemented, what edge cases it covers, and any known limitations. The interface should support scenario testing, letting users simulate what-if changes and observe potential downstream effects. This capability is invaluable for debugging, as it enables teams to anticipate consequences before deploying updates and to compare results across different policy configurations.
In practice, embedding debugging aids into dashboards reduces cycle time for fixes. When an anomaly is detected, the system should trace it back to the exact origin, whether it’s a data source issue, a faulty join, or a misconfigured aggregation. The user experience should guide engineers step by step through the lineage, showing linked logs, source file revisions, and execution traces. A robust design also provides remediation workflows, allowing users to annotate issues, assign owners, and attach evidence. Together, these features create a proactive environment for maintaining data reliability.
The long-term payoff of well-designed dashboards is tangible: increased trust, faster debugging, and stronger governance. By combining lineage visualization with transformation details, stakeholders gain a holistic view of how data products evolve. It’s important to enforce consistent data quality checks at every stage and to surface those checks within the dashboard context. Integrating test results, schema drift alerts, and performance metrics helps teams detect regressions early. A culture of openness—where lineage and logic are accessible—reduces guesswork and supports data-driven decision making across departments and external partners.
As organizations scale, dashboards must adapt without sacrificing usability. Design for modularity, so new data sources, transformed assets, and rules can be added without overhauling the interface. Maintain stable visualization primitives and rely on expressive metadata to keep content meaningful after changes. Regular reviews of governance policies, combined with user feedback, ensure the dashboard remains relevant for audits, debugging, and ongoing compliance. In the end, dashboards that make lineage and transformation logic visible become critical infrastructure for trustworthy analytics, enabling teams to learn, improve, and innovate with confidence.
Related Articles
Discover practical approaches that empower teams to annotate, discuss, and preserve tacit insights directly inside dashboards, transforming fragmented experiences into a shared, durable knowledge base across data-driven workflows.
July 24, 2025
This evergreen guide reveals a practical framework for integrating financial metrics, operational performance data, and customer signals into dashboards that empower cohesive, strategic decision making across the organization.
July 29, 2025
A practical, evergreen guide to embedding continuous customer feedback into dashboards so teams translate insights into tangible product improvements with speed and clarity.
August 11, 2025
Designing dashboards that illuminate feature flags, track rollout milestones, and connect experimentation to key performance indicators requires a deliberate structure, reliable data sources, and clear visual conventions for product teams.
August 12, 2025
A practical guide to aligning dashboard roadmaps across departments, balancing competing priorities, and unlocking collective value through governance, collaboration, and scalable analytics investments that endure.
August 08, 2025
A practical guide for plant managers to construct dashboards that clearly reveal multistep workflows, production yields, quality inspections, and bottlenecks across the entire manufacturing line.
July 18, 2025
A practical guide to forming a governance board that defines dashboard standards, prioritizes roadmaps, and retires outdated reports, ensuring consistent, trustworthy analytics across an organization.
July 24, 2025
This article explores practical, repeatable design methods for dashboards that visualize supplier risk heatmaps by integrating financial, operational, and compliance indicators, helping teams make quicker, better risk judgments across complex supplier networks.
August 07, 2025
Designing dashboards that clearly show how platform changes affect business outcomes requires clarity, alignment with strategy, and a disciplined storytelling approach that translates technical gains into measurable value across stakeholders.
July 18, 2025
This evergreen guide explores practical approaches for embedding consent-aware analytics within dashboards, ensuring user preferences are honored without compromising data utility, accuracy, or actionable insights across diverse business contexts.
July 21, 2025
This guide explores semantic layers as the backbone of dashboards, enabling consistent metrics, centralized business rules, and reusable logic across teams, platforms, and data sources.
July 19, 2025
Effective donor reporting hinges on dashboards that accurately map contributions to outcomes, illustrate program impact through compelling stories, and convey measurable progress with transparent, accessible visuals for stakeholders.
July 18, 2025
Strategic guidelines for building dashboards that map engagement stages, annotate conversion points, highlight drop-offs, and enable quick, data-informed decision making across product, marketing, and analytics teams.
July 19, 2025
When outages strike, a well crafted single-pane dashboard guides commanders through rapid decision making, integrates diverse data streams, highlights priorities, and coordinates multi-team responses with clarity, speed, and confidence.
July 18, 2025
This evergreen guide outlines practical, repeatable design strategies for dashboards that clearly track contract performance, milestone adherence, and payment schedules within PMO environments, empowering stakeholders to act decisively and align resources efficiently.
July 16, 2025
Transitioning from legacy reporting to modern BI demands deliberate change management, clear governance, user empathy, phased rollouts, and ongoing learning to ensure adoption, accuracy, and measurable value across the enterprise.
July 19, 2025
This guide explores a practical, scalable approach to syncing dashboards with live transactions using event streams, microservices, and robust data pipelines, ensuring automatic, timely updates with minimal latency and maintenance overhead.
July 24, 2025
This evergreen guide explains a practical approach to dashboards designed for cross-functional governance, focusing on layered metrics, compelling storytelling, and actionable recommendations that align teams toward shared strategic outcomes.
July 26, 2025
Embedding governance checkpoints into dashboard release workflows creates resilient, auditable processes that minimize regressions, ensure compliance, and maintain data integrity across complex BI environments while accelerating secure delivery.
August 12, 2025
Crafting dashboards that unify web, mobile, and offline signals requires thoughtful data architecture, modeling, and visualization. This article outlines enduring strategies for comprehensive omnichannel insight across channels and time.
July 15, 2025